Soldering has its given area of use
when joining material to objects, where one cannot or does
not want to use welding because of much higher working temperatures
and its limitations when it comes to joining different metals.
When soldering the joint surfaces are heated only at or
precisely above the respective solders melting temperature
which is always lower than the basic material’s melting
temperature, at which the solder melts and "rolls over"
the joint surfaces.
